This is a landscape painting made by Johan Christian Dahl in the early 19th century, though the exact date is unknown. The painting invites us to consider the cultural movement of Romanticism, which focused on the beauty and power of nature as a source of spiritual and emotional experience. Produced in the context of the rise of nationalism in Europe, paintings like this promoted a shared cultural identity linked to the natural landscape. Dahl, a Norwegian artist, was active in Denmark and Germany, and through his art he contributed to a broader Scandinavian artistic identity. We can interpret the image as using visual codes to create meaning. It is likely this painting aimed to evoke feelings of awe, reverence, and emotional connection to a specific place. If we want to understand the social conditions that shaped the artistic production, it would be useful to know where this painting was exhibited. The historical record of exhibitions and sales provides insights into the intended audience, market reception, and cultural impact of Dahl's work.
